1954 Austin-Healey 100 vs. 2008 Tata Indigo
To start off, 2008 Tata Indigo is newer by 54 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1954 Austin-Healey 100.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1954 Austin-Healey 100 would be higher. At 2,660 cc (4 cylinders), 1954 Austin-Healey 100 is equipped with a bigger engine.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2008 Tata Indigo weights approximately 195 kg more than 1954 Austin-Healey 100.
Let's talk about torque, 1954 Austin-Healey 100 (144 Nm @ 2500 RPM) has 23 more torque (in Nm) than 2008 Tata Indigo. (121 Nm @ 3000 RPM). This means 1954 Austin-Healey 100 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2008 Tata Indigo.
